More jobs:
Full Stack Engineer
Job in
Reston, Fairfax County, Virginia, 22090, USA
Listed on 2026-06-01
Listing for:
CACI International Inc.
Full Time
position Listed on 2026-06-01
Job specializations:
-
IT/Tech
Systems Engineer, Cybersecurity, Cloud Computing, IT Support
Job Description & How to Apply Below
Full Stack Engineer
Job Category:
Engineering
Time Type:
Full time
Minimum Clearance Required to Start:
None
Employee Type:
Regular
Percentage of
Travel Required:
None
Type of Travel:
None
* *
* The Opportunity:
* Join the Edge Business Applications (EBA) team, a multi-year strategic project and one of the three core pillars of the Afloat Modernization initiative for the MSC IBS program.
* Build and maintain a robust platform infrastructure for Afloat environments that will host modernized, containerized applications deployed across MSC's logistics ships.
* Work in a fast-paced environment using cutting-edge technologies including AWS services, EKS, K3S, Kubernetes, Terraform, Ansible, and modern Dev Ops practices.
* Collaborate with the teams to support parallel modernization and containerization efforts for legacy Afloat applications.
* Contribute across the full technology stack-backend, frontend, Infrastructure as Code (IaC), and automation-while growing your skills in a mission-critical defense environment.
Responsibilities:
* Develop and maintain frontend applications using HTML, CSS, and React.js to create intuitive user interfaces.
* Build and optimize backend services including API development and database design to support platform functionality.
* Implement and manage infrastructure solutions using scripting, Ansible, Docker, and Kubernetes for containerized environments.
* Contribute to architecture design and develop prototypes to validate and test architectural components.
* Participate in design, development, and debugging discussions, bringing technical knowledge and problem-solving expertise to the team.
* Collaborate with cross-functional teams including clients and internal stakeholders to gather requirements, provide updates, and unblock tasks.
* Work on Infrastructure as Code (IaC) implementations using Terraform, Ansible, and automation solutions to streamline deployment and operations.
* Conduct troubleshooting, log analysis, and performance tuning to ensure system reliability and optimal performance.
* Perform security and vulnerability analysis including CVE review and remediation, third-party dependency management, and STIG compliance.
* Participate in technical demonstrations and presentations to showcase project progress and capabilities.
Qualifications:
Required:
* U.S. Citizenship with the ability to obtain and maintain a Secret security clearance.
* Bachelor's degree in computer science or related field.
* 10+ years of professional software development experience.
* Proficiency in multiple programming languages and technologies including HTML, JavaScript, Type Script, CSS, React, jQuery, JSON, RESTful API development, NodeJS, NPM, Java, Maven, and Git.
* Experience with open source container infrastructure including Docker, Docker Compose, Docker Swarm, Kubernetes, or Podman.
* Knowledge of Linux system configuration including package installation and maintenance, network interface configuration, and firewall configuration.
* Experience building and working in Event Driven Microservice environments utilizing technologies like Kafka, MQTT, AWS SQS, and AWS SNS.
* Understanding of Unit Testing, Pre-Commit Hooks, Linters, Debugging, and Performance Monitoring and Analysis.
* Experience in troubleshooting, log analysis, performance tuning, disaster recovery, and backup/restore processes.
* Knowledge of security practices including CVE review and remediation, third-party dependency management, and Security Technical Implementation Guide (STIG) compliance.
* Strong verbal, written, interpersonal, troubleshooting, and analytical skills.
* Obtain Security+ certification as an immediate priority during onboarding if not currently held.
Desired:
* Master's degree in computer science or related field.
* Active Security+ certification or willingness to obtain immediately upon hire.
* Understanding of Public Key Infrastructure (PKI) including certificate management, renewal, and revocation incorporating technologies like Certificate Revocation Lists (CRL).
* Experience with AWS Gov Cloud and AWS core services.
* Hands-on experience with EKS, K3S, RHEL, Artifactory, Rancher, and Git Lab.
* Experience with Infrastructure as Code tools, particularly Terraform and Ansible.
* Knowledge of CQRS (Command Query Responsibility Segregation) and JWT (JSON Web Tokens).
* Prior experience working on defense or government projects with strict security and compliance requirements.
* Experience working in Agile/Scrum environments supporting mission-critical applications.
* What You Can Expect:
A culture of integrity.
At CACI, we place character and innovation at the center of everything we do. As a valued team member, you'll be part of a high-performing group dedicated to our customer's missions and driven by a higher purpose - to ensure the safety of our nation.
An environment of trust.
CACI values the unique contributions that every employee brings to our company and our customers - every day. You'll have the autonomy to take the time you need…
To View & Apply for jobs on this site that accept applications from your location or country, tap the button below to make a Search.
(If this job is in fact in your jurisdiction, then you may be using a Proxy or VPN to access this site, and to progress further, you should change your connectivity to another mobile device or PC).
(If this job is in fact in your jurisdiction, then you may be using a Proxy or VPN to access this site, and to progress further, you should change your connectivity to another mobile device or PC).
Search for further Jobs Here:
×